Remote setting of day, night, holiday and auto modes
Normally, the system’s day/night mode operation will be manually controlled at a Digital Feature
Phone and/or set to follow the day/night mode tables (programmed by the Installer) automatically.
In addition, the Administrator can remotely change the mode and/or re-record the holiday greeting
to handle unexpected closings such as for inclement weather.
Remotely logging into the system with the Installer or Administrator password will allow the caller
to re-record the holiday greeting and manually change the mode for day/night/holiday/auto.
1.
At the main greeting, enter * *
7 8 9 #
or
4 5 6 #
— or the new password — to enter
remote programming mode.
2.
You’ll hear prompts that will allow you to change the answer mode (day, night, holiday
or auto) and/or to re-record the holiday greeting. Follow the prompts to perform the
desired operation.
3.
Exit by pressing * and hanging up.
Day/night mode worksheet example
In the example below, the company has night mode programmed for
After normal hours
• Lunchtime
Wednesday and Saturday after 2:00 PM
All day Sunday

Note:
For the schedule to take effect, the system must be placed in theauto mode.
